De wesp in het toilet

Een vreemde titel wellicht voor Home Automation maar ik zal uitleggen waarom dat interessant is in domotica.

Een ruimte voorzien van één of meer deuren (hierna te noemen ‘box‘) kan gesloten zijn waardoor deze box dicht is en een binnengevlogen wesp (Engels: wasp) er niet uit kan vliegen. Zodra één van de deuren open gaan kan de wesp eruit vliegen en is de box leeg (van wespen).

Vertaald naar domotica: een ruimte (box) met deuren waarop deur-sensors zijn geplaatst kan dus in Home Assistant aangeven of één of meer deuren van die ruimte open of dicht zijn. Door in de ruimte ook een bewegings-melder te plaatsen kan tevens gedetecteerd worden of er iemand (wasp) aanwezig is.

Wasp-in-a-Box

Via HACS kan de repository https://github.com/dlashua/hass-wasp_sensor toegevoegd worden waardoor de Integratie ‘Wasp-in-a-Box‘ toegevoegd worden door een stukje yaml-code in configuration.yaml op te nemen. Bijvoorbeeld:

wasp_sensor:
- name: toilet
  wasp_sensors:
    - binary_sensor.minisensortoilet_occupancy
  box_sensors:
    - binary_sensor.deursensor_contact
  • De wasp_sensors is de bewegingsmelder die een persoon kunnen detecteren,
  • De box_sensors is de deur-sensor van de ruimte.
  • De sensor wordt dan binary_sensor.wasp_sensor_toilet

De praktijk

Zodra iemand de deur van het toilet opent en de ruimte betreedt, zullen zowel de wasp_sensors als de box_sensors true worden waardoor de binary_sensor.wasp_sensor_toilet op ‘on’ komt te staan. Naar goed gebruik zal de persoon in het toilet de deur dicht doen tijdens het bezoek en zolang blijft dus de wasp in the box!

Eenmaal het bezoek aan het toilet afgelopen is zal de deur nogmaals open gaan (the wasp is out of the box!) en zal de binary_sensor.wasp_sensor_toilet op ‘off’ komen te staan.

Met behulp van deze binary_sensor.wasp_sensor_toilet zou dus de verlichting in het toilet geschakeld kunnen worden.